Scratch中的音乐制作技巧
发布时间: 2023-12-19 15:03:34 阅读量: 44 订阅数: 50
# 第一章:认识Scratch音乐制作界面
Scratch是一款由麻省理工学院设计的编程工具,它不仅可以用来编程和制作动画,还可以进行音乐制作。在Scratch中,音乐制作工具被集成在作品编辑界面中,让用户可以在创作过程中即时添加音乐元素,让作品更加生动有趣。
## 介绍Scratch中的音乐制作工具
Scratch中的音乐制作工具主要包括“声音”栏和“声音编辑器”。在“声音”栏中,用户可以导入音频文件或使用预设的声音素材,而“声音编辑器”则提供了丰富的音乐制作功能,包括音符、音阶、音调变化等。
## 理解音符、音阶和音符块的概念
在Scratch中,音符是音乐的基本元素,音阶是一系列音符的排列,而音符块则是Scratch中用来表示音符和音阶的编程块,通过拖拽和组合不同的音符块,可以创建丰富多彩的音乐效果。
## 快速上手Scratch音乐编辑器
Scratch音乐编辑器的操作界面简单直观,用户可以通过拖拽音符块、调整音符时长和音调高低,轻松创建自己的音乐作品。接下来,我们将详细介绍如何使用Scratch音乐编辑器来制作音乐节奏和旋律。
## 第二章:创建简单的音乐节奏
在Scratch中,创建简单的音乐节奏非常有趣而且直观。通过使用循环和节奏块,你可以轻松地设计出基本的鼓点和节奏。
### 使用循环和节奏块创建基本的鼓点
在Scratch的音乐制作界面中,你可以找到各种节奏块,比如``play drum``,``rest``等,通过简单的拖拽操作就可以组合出自己想要的鼓点节奏。
#### 代码示例:
```javascript
when green flag clicked
forever
play drum (1 v) for (0.2) beats
rest for (0.2) beats
```
在这段代码中,当绿旗被点击后,程序会一直循环播放鼓声和休息,从而形成基本的节奏。
#### 代码说明:
- ``when green flag clicked``:当绿旗被点击时开始执行代码。
- ``forever``:无限循环的代码块,用于持续播放音乐节奏。
- ``play drum (1 v) for (0.2) beats``:播放编号为1的鼓声,持续0.2拍。
- ``rest for (0.2) beats``:休息0.2拍,用于控制节奏的间隔。
### 探索不同的鼓声和音效
在Scratch的音乐库中,有各种不同的鼓声和音效可以供你使用,你可以根据自己的喜好和创作需要进行选择和尝试。
### 如何在Scratch中设计迷人的节
0
0